(HMG) – “The Hurt Locker” star Jeremy Renner is set to move from the battlefield to another deadly mission, as co-star to Tom Cruise in “Mission: Impossible IV.” According to Deadline Hollywood Renner is currently in negotiations with Paramount Pictures to take on the role as Cruise’s partner in “Mission: Impossible IV”. While there were many hot actors considered for the role, including Tom Hardy, Chris Pine, Kevin Zegers, Christopher Egan and Anthony Mackie, production chief Adam Goodman is said to have thought the 39-year-old Renner “has a Daniel Craig quality” and the heft to carry the franchise. Which is necessary because the studio has been looking for an actor who could potentially continue the franchise should Cruise not return in the next installment, as Ethan Hunt. In the meantime Renner will be staying busy, starring opposite Ben Affleck in “The Town” which is set to come out in the U.S. on September 17. Renner will also take a role of Hawkeye in Joss Whedon-directed “The Avengers” which is expected to start production in early 2011.
